What Are Dental Implants? Dental implants are little titanium posts that function as synthetic tooth roots. They're surgically placed into your jawbone, where they fuse with the bone through a process called osseointegration. As soon as healed, the implant supplies a durable base for a replacement tooth, generally a crown, bridge, or denture. The structure of an oral implant typically consists of: Implant post-- The titanium screw inserted into the jawbone. Abutment-- A connector piece that attaches the implant to the replacement tooth. Remediation-- The visible part of the tooth, typically a customized crown. This three-part design ensures stability and sturdiness, enabling implants to imitate the function of natural teeth. Who Is an Excellent Prospect for Dental Implants in Jacksonville? Many healthy adults are prospects for dental implants, however certain factors affect eligibility: Sufficient jawbone density-- Adequate bone is needed to anchor the implant. Healthy gums-- Good gum health is crucial for implant success. Non-smoker or going to give up-- Cigarette smoking slows recovery and increases the risk of failure. Overall health-- Conditions like unrestrained diabetes might require extra evaluation. If you have actually been told you don't have enough bone for implants, do not stress. Many Jacksonville dental experts offer bone grafting or sinus lift treatments to make implants possible. The Dental Implant Process: Action by Action Getting oral implants in Jacksonville, FL is a multi-stage procedure that usually takes a number of months. Here's what you can expect: Preliminary Assessment Your dental professional will review your case history, take X-rays or 3D scans, and create a custom treatment strategy. Tooth Extraction (if essential) If a harmed tooth is still present, it may require to be eliminated before the implant is positioned. Bone Grafting (if needed) If your jawbone isn't thick enough, implanting material may be included to enhance the area. Healing typically takes a couple of months - dental implants jacksonville. Implant Placement The titanium post is surgically placed into the jawbone. Healing and fusion (osseointegration) can take 3 to 6 months. Abutment Placement When healed, a small connector is attached to the implant. This step might require small surgery. Crown Positioning Finally, a personalized crown is connected to finish your smile restoration. How Long Do Oral Implants Last? One of the biggest benefits of oral implants is longevity. With good oral health and routine dental checkups, implants can last twenty years or more, frequently a lifetime. The crown might require replacement every 10 to 15 years due to typical wear and tear, however the titanium post itself is designed to be irreversible. How Much Do Oral Implants Cost in Jacksonville, FL? The expense of oral implants in Jacksonville varies based upon numerous elements, including the variety of teeth being replaced and whether additional procedures like bone grafting are required. Usually: Single implant-- $3,000 to $5,000 per tooth Implant-supported bridge-- $6,000 to $10,000 Full-mouth implants (All-on-4 or All-on-6)-- $20,000 to $40,000 per arch While implants can be more costly upfront than dentures or bridges, they typically prove more affordable in the long run because of their toughness and low maintenance. Many Jacksonville dental offices likewise use funding alternatives to make treatment more inexpensive. Do Dental Insurance Coverage Plans Cover Implants? Coverage depends on your plan. Some dental insurance suppliers in Jacksonville offer partial coverage for implants, particularly if missing teeth was triggered by an accident or medical condition. Others might cover the crown or abutment but not the implant post itself. It's best to contact your supplier and ask your dentist's workplace for help in evaluating your advantages. Lots of practices also supply versatile payment strategies. Recovery and Aftercare Healing from implant surgical treatment is typically uncomplicated. A lot of clients in Jacksonville experience mild swelling, bruising, or discomfort for a few days, which can be handled with non-prescription pain medication. To guarantee successful healing: Follow your dental practitioner's aftercare instructions. Stay with soft foods for the very first week. Maintain outstanding oral health to prevent infection. Prevent smoking, which postpones healing. Routine dental examinations are vital to keep track of implant health and capture any potential issues early. Dental Implants vs. Other Tooth Replacement Options If you're thinking about alternatives, here's how implants compare: Dentures-- Less costly but can slip, need adhesives, and do not prevent bone loss. Bridges-- A quicker option however require grinding down nearby teeth for assistance. Implants-- Steady, natural-looking, preserve bone, and do not affect close-by teeth.
